整篇文章保存报错内存溢出,所以只能分为上下两部分发布了。
之前统一管理非生产数据库的Oracle 11g GC(Grid Co)环境所用虚机被破坏了,导致无法访问,干脆安装CC(Cloud Control)新环境,现在Oracle提供了12c CC和13c CC两个大版本的安装介质,可以从如下链接找到对应版本,
http://www.oracle.com/technetwork/oem/enterprise-manager/downloads/index.html
这里我选择的是Oracle Enterprise Manager Cloud Control 12c Release 5 (12.1.0.5),可以看见其中已经包含了weblogic 10.3.6版本的安装介质,
一、安装准备
首先需要确保有jdk 1.6以上的环境,
此处原始有多个版本的java,
第一次安装的时候未使用上面CC自带的wls1036_generic.jar,而是使用了下载的wls1036_linux32.bin,安装过程中报了jdk环境的错误,
可以卸载这些java,
但建议还是使用CC自带的wls安装介质,这样才能保证绝对的兼容。
如果有强迫症,或是就要挑战wls1036_linux32.bin,还要安装glibc.i686,否则报错,
./wls1036_linux32.bin: /lib/ld-linux.so.2: bad ELF interpreter
二、安装weblogic
执行java -d64 -jar wls1036_generic.jar,可选择JDK环境,接下来选择安装目录等常规操作即可。
卸载可以执行,/u01/app/oracle/Middleware_32/wlserver_10.3/uninstall/uninstall.sh
三、安装CC
执行install.sh
此处可以不选择注册,
跳过自动更新,
选择Inventory目录,此处为所有Oracle产品软件安装的汇总信息目录,
接下来会做各种安装检查,包括各种包、文件空间、系统参数限制,
这检查出了open files参数限制过低,
需要调整,
根据错误提示做调整后,可以选择rerun,
接下来选择Advanced高级安装,
设置Server和Agent安装路径,同时指定安装主机的主机名,
这提示Oracle建议使用带完整域名来代替这的简称,防止冲突。可以忽略。
此处可以选择除了基本组件之外的一些扩展组件,比如Tomcat管理组件,
输入weblogic和节点控制器的密码,以及OMS实例的根目录。
选择CC使用的数据库信息,
提交的时候会提示一些不满足要求的数据库配置,
这里提示的错误包括,
1.临时表空间需要设置为AUTOEXTEND自动扩展。
2.memory_target参数值设置。
3.shared_pool_size参数值设置。
4.redo日志大小。
此处可以暂不解决,以后再说。
设置SYSMAN管理账号密码、Agent注册密码,会自动设置CC使用的表空间路径和文件名,
列出了所有CC使用的端口,可以使用netstat确保无占用,
安装总结,
开始安装,
建议同时打开本地日志文件,tail -f实时查看,
第一次安装的时候,曾经中间出现了错误,
查看Tomcat组件安装的报错,
此时无法不安装这个组件,所以抱着试一试的心态,重新点击了retry,继续了。。。
用root执行以下两个脚本,
完成安装,